Cathi Walkup, Jennifer Lee, Leanne Weatherly and Melissa Dinwiddie, four four of the Bay Area's top Jazz singer/songwriters take the stage in the round for an evening of original music.
Vocalist/lyricist/composer Cathi Walkup has been called "the thinking person's jazz singer" for her love of lyric driven songs, "a natural comedian" for her wit and ease on-stage, and "an important bop oriented singer, who is also an excellent lyricist" by jazz writer Scott Yanow in his new book "The Jazz Singers, The Ultimate Guide".
Jennifer Lee is a vocalist/pianist/guitarist with a warm, lovely voice, extraordinary musicality and hip sense of time. Jennifer frequently accompanies herself on guitar or piano with a simple elegance and sweetness while maintaining a deep, in the pocket groove.
Renowned pianist Taylor Eigisti (Concord Music Group) has said of Leanne Weatherly, the originator of the group, "she's got clarity, passion and fun arrangements that anyone would enjoy, wall wrapped up in a very bright future."
Singer/songwriter Meilssa Dinwiddie delights listeners with her upbeat voice and engaging and sometimes comedic delivery. Self titled the Queen of Dating, two of her original compositions, "He's Just Not That Into You" and "Online Dating Blues" are audience favorites.
